David, known as Pop, suddenly entered into the arms of his Lord and Savior on March 14, 2023 due to heart failure. David was the oldest son born on January 23, 1950 to Keith and Mary Lee Barnard in Lubbock, TX. David attended Lakeside School kindergarten through eighth grade in Old River, CA...
